A healthy and tasty chicken salad with a fruity twist - great on a croissant or in a honey pita. The salad is best if eaten the day after preparation. This allows the ingredients time to mingle, giving a fuller flavor.
Ingredients
- 4 skinless , boneless chicken breast halves - cooked and diced
- 1 stalk celery , chopped
- ½ onion , chopped
- 1 small apple - peeled , cored and chopped
- 0.33 cups golden raisins
- 0.33 cups seedless green grapes , halved
- 0.5 cups chopped toasted pecans
- 0.13 teaspoons ground black pepper
- 0.5 teaspoons curry powder
- 0.75 cups mayonnaise
Instructions
-
1
In a large salad bowl combine the chicken, celery, onion, apple, raisins, grapes, pecans, pepper, curry powder and mayonnaise. Mix all together, tossing to coat. Salad is ready to serve!
